Heating and cooling services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of systems that regulate indoor temperature and air quality. These services ensure that heating units such as furnaces and heat pumps operate efficiently during colder months, while air conditioning systems provide relief during warmer periods. Properly functioning heating and cooling systems help maintain a comfortable environment inside homes and other properties, making them essential for year-round comfort.

This type of service helps address common problems like system breakdowns, uneven heating or cooling, strange noises, and increased energy bills. Over time, components like filters, thermostats, or ductwork may wear out or become damaged, leading to reduced performance or system failure. Regular inspections and timely repairs by local contractors can prevent small issues from escalating into costly replacements, ensuring that systems run smoothly and efficiently when needed most.

Properties that typically use heating and cooling services include single-family homes, multi-unit residential buildings, and even some commercial spaces. Homes with central HVAC systems, ductless units, or older heating appliances often require professional assistance to optimize performance or resolve issues. These services are also relevant for properties undergoing renovations or upgrades, where new systems are installed or existing systems are replaced to meet current standards and comfort needs.

Homeowners should consider heating and cooling services whenever they notice changes in system performance, such as inconsistent temperatures, unusual noises, or increased energy costs. Routine maintenance can also help extend the lifespan of equipment and improve efficiency. The overview below groups typical Heating And Cooling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ine repairs like fixing a thermostat or replacing a small component generally range from $150 to $400. Many common j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end for more complex repairs.

System Tune-Ups - Regular maintenance services such as cleaning and inspections usually cost between $100 and $300. These services are often priced in the lower to mid-range, depending on the size of the system and the extent of the tune-up needed.

Full System Replacement - Replacing an entire heating or cooling system can range from $3,000 to $7,000 or more for standard units. Larger, more complex projects or premium systems can push costs above $10,000, though most installations fall within the middle of this range.

Large-Scale Installations or Custom Projects - Custom or extensive HVAC installations, including ductwork or multi-zone systems, typically start around $8,000 and can exceed $20,000. These higher-tier projects are less common and depend heavily on the scope and specifications of the work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What heating and cooling services do local contractors provide? Local contractors typically offer installation, repair, and maintenance services for heating systems like furnaces and boilers, as well as cooling systems such as air conditioners and heat pumps.

How can I determine which heating or cooling system is right for my home? Service providers can assess your space and recommend suitable systems based on your home's size, layout, and comfort preferences.

Are there specific signs that indicate a heating or cooling system needs repair? Common signs include inconsistent temperatures, unusual noises, increased energy bills, or system failure, which local contractors can evaluate.

What maintenance services do heating and cooling systems require? Regular filter replacements, system inspections, cleaning, and tune-ups are typical maintenance tasks performed by local service providers.
